International Virtual Business

International Virtual Business is a one-year program for students interested in the exciting and ever-changing worlds of business, free enterprise and entrepreneurship. By creating and operating their own model business, students experience all facets of running a successful firm, including product development, production and distribution; administration; accounting and finance; human resources; marketing and sales; and purchasing.

Students also learn from local businesspersons who serve as advisors to each student business team. International Virtual Business students connect with their peers from around the state, country and world and participate in an annual Virtual Enterprise competition and conference.

Students may earn credit for economics and integrated English, and college credit through articulation agreements.

Upon completion, students may enter
college or the workforce. Information is available at www.veinternational.org

PORTFOLIO:
Students create a portfolio which they present to teachers, administrators, peers and/or industry professionals. The portfolio includes employability information and exemplary work in technical and communication skills that students have created and developed over the course of the year.
